Sixteen 14 Global

Recently, while doing my normal search of the internet, trying to find some great new & unsigned talent for the show, I came across some articles in Marie Claire magazine that featured some amazing unsigned acts. The articles were a great read, but more noticeably was the real passion for the music that could be felt in the writing. I noticed that all the articles were written by the same author, a man called Michael Anderson. I was so impressed by Michael's writing and his passion for music that I decided to find out a bit more about him.
Michael turned out to be a founding member (along with David Goodbury) of the influential LA/London based “Boutique” Music Supervision & Artist Management company called “Sixteen 14 Global”.
S14G are an elite company who not only  consult and manage artists, but are also highly specialist & focused on Music Licensing for US & UK Television & Film. These guys have worked with some of the biggest TV/Film & music companies on the planet. Here is just a small list of who they have already worked with in the past

CHOP SHOP MUSIC, LONE WOLF MUSIC, METALMAN MEDIA, PARAMOUNT TELEVISION, SONY PICTURES, WARNER BROS TELEVISION, NBC, CBS, EMI (UK), LOWER MARS GAMING, PHANTOM (UK), THE NAIM LABELS (UK), THE LOCAL (UK), BACK YARD RECORDINGS (UK),  ABC/DISNEY TELEVISION, PARAMOUNT PICTURES, NBC/UNIVERSAL, HOT TOPIC, KIPLING MEDIA (UK), BURBERRY, ALEXANDER WANG, GQ Magazine, MARIE CLAIRE Magazine.
